Dr. Grove joined the Marketing Department in the fall of 1986. Previously, he had been on the faculty of the University of Mississippi.

PUBLICATIONS
Dr. Grove's articles have appeared in the Journal of Macromarketing, Journal of Retailing, Journal of Business Research, Journal of Services Research, Journal of Advertising, Journal of Public Policy and Marketing, The Service Industry Journal, Journal of the Academy of Marketing Science, Journal of Services Marketing, Journal of Personal Selling and Management, Journal of Current Issues and Research in Advertising, European Journal of Marketing, International Marketing Review, Journal of Business Ethics, Journal of Health Care Marketing, Journal of Marketing Education, Journal of Education for Business, Journal of International Consumer Marketing, Psychological Reports, Journal of Business and Industrial Marketing, Journal of Marketing Theory and Practice, Journal of Teaching International Business, Tourism Analysis, Marketing Intelligence and Planning, Journal of Sport Behavior, International Journal of Sport Psychology, and several others, as well as numerous international, national and regional conference proceedings.
Dr. Grove's work has also appeared in various edited volumes, including Advances in Services Marketing and Management, Contemporary Services Marketing and Management, and the Handbook of Services Marketing and Management. He is the co-author of a text, Interactive Services Marketing, that is now in its second edition, as well as the book, A Services Marketing Introspection: Snapshots, Reflections and Glimpses from the Experts. Currently under development is a third book, Service Theater: A Model for Success in Today's Experience Economy. Dr. Grove is past chairperson of the American Marketing Association's Services Marketing Special Interest Group (SERVSIG), Co-Chair of the 2001 American Marketing Association Summer Educator's Conference, and currently a member of the American Marketing Association's Academic Council.
In addition, Dr. Grove has served as guest editor for special editions of the European Journal of Marketing and the Journal of Advertising and has written for Marketing News and the Marketing Educator. He received the 2001 Eli Lilly Faculty Excellence Award for Outstanding Research and the 2000-2001 Senior Scholar Research Excellence Award from the College of Business and Behavioral Science at Clemson.
